Product Description

The cable has a length of 15 feet and a thickness of 3/8-inches (480 cm x 10 mm).
A double looped cable that works with all kinds of locks, disc locks, and U locks

In order to protect myself, I needed some form of anti-bacterial This is to protect an electric smoker and grill that I have on my deck from theft. By threading the cable through the handles on both items and looping it around a steel pole nearby, I was able to attach them. I was completely satisfied with how it worked. A saw would need to be used to cut through this material, as it is very strong. There will be no case where someone decides to take my smoker or grill, either as a joke In order to keep the two ends of the cable together, you will need a combination lock. It takes no time at all to set up either the smoker or grill all I have to do is unlock the lock and remove the cable connecting the unit I wish to use. Then, I loop the cable one last time through the handle and secure the two ends of the cord. The solution is very simple but has a lot of power.
